A helmet can meet the required specification.
A pair of gloves can provide the required protection.
A safety shoe can have the right protective features.
A coverall can be made from the specified fabric.
But there is another question that is often overlooked:
Does the PPE actually fit the person who has to wear it?
Fit is sometimes treated as a comfort issue.
In reality, it can affect much more than comfort.
Poorly fitting PPE can restrict movement, create pressure points, interfere with other equipment, encourage workers to adjust or remove the product, and make protective equipment more difficult to use correctly.
For PPE buyers, therefore, fit should not be treated as a cosmetic detail or an optional comfort feature.
It is part of how protective equipment performs in the real workplace.
PPE Is Designed for People, Not Product Shelves
A PPE product can look perfect in a catalog photograph.
But a catalog does not show:
- How it fits different body shapes
- How it feels after several hours
- Whether it restricts movement
- Whether it stays in position during work
- Whether workers can operate tools while wearing it
- Whether it interferes with other PPE
This is particularly important because PPE is worn while people are moving, lifting, climbing, bending, reaching, walking, or performing repetitive tasks.
A product that fits well when standing still may behave differently when the worker starts working.
That is why PPE fit should be evaluated in relation to the task, not just the product itself.
What Does “Good Fit” Actually Mean?
Good PPE fit does not necessarily mean tight.
It does not necessarily mean loose either.
A useful fit should provide the right balance between:
Protection + Stability + Movement + Comfort + Usability
Depending on the product, this may mean:
- The helmet remains securely positioned.
- Eye protection stays aligned with the face.
- Gloves allow the required finger movement.
- Safety footwear holds the foot securely without creating excessive pressure.
- Protective clothing allows workers to bend and reach.
- High-visibility garments remain properly positioned.
- Respiratory protection can maintain the intended fit when designed for the wearer and application.
The correct fit is therefore not simply about choosing the right size on a label.
It is about whether the PPE performs properly while the worker is actually using it.
1. Poor Fit Can Change How PPE Is Used
One of the biggest problems with poorly fitting PPE is what happens after the product is issued.
Workers may:
- Loosen straps
- Roll up sleeves
- Remove protective layers
- Wear equipment incorrectly
- Avoid using certain items
- Replace required PPE with a more comfortable alternative
These behaviors can reduce the effectiveness of a protection program.
This is why PPE selection should consider not only:
Can the product provide the required protection?
but also:
Can workers realistically use it as intended?
A technically suitable product that is consistently worn incorrectly may not deliver the practical benefit expected from the purchase.
2. Fit Is Different Across PPE Categories
There is no single definition of “good fit” for every type of PPE.
Each category creates different requirements.
Safety Helmets
For head protection, buyers may need to consider:
- Head-size range
- Adjustment system
- Stability
- Harness configuration
- Weight
- Compatibility with other accessories
A helmet that moves excessively during work may be distracting or difficult to use correctly.
At the same time, excessive pressure can make long-duration use uncomfortable.
The goal is a stable fit without unnecessary discomfort.
Safety Gloves
Gloves need to balance:
Protection + Dexterity + Grip + Fit
A glove that is too loose may reduce control and interfere with handling.
A glove that is too tight may restrict movement and create discomfort.
For tasks requiring precision, finger movement can be particularly important.
The right glove therefore depends not only on the hazard but also on what the worker needs to do with their hands.
Safety Footwear
Safety footwear should provide appropriate protection while allowing workers to walk and work comfortably.
Fit considerations may include:
- Length
- Width
- Heel stability
- Toe-box space
- Internal volume
- Closure system
- Sock compatibility
A footwear model that works well for one foot shape may not feel the same for another.
This is one reason size charts alone do not always tell the entire story.
Protective Clothing
Protective clothing creates a different challenge.
It needs to provide appropriate coverage without unnecessarily restricting movement.
Consider a worker who needs to:
- Bend
- Kneel
- Climb
- Reach overhead
- Walk repeatedly
- Operate equipment
A garment that fits perfectly while standing may become restrictive when the worker performs these movements.
For workwear and protective garments, functional fit can therefore be more important than appearance.
3. One Size Strategy Does Not Always Fit Every Workforce
A procurement team may prefer to reduce the number of sizes it stocks.
That can simplify purchasing and inventory.
But excessive size consolidation can create problems.
For example, offering only:
M / L / XL
may be convenient for procurement.
But a workforce may include people with significantly different:
- Heights
- Body proportions
- Chest measurements
- Waist measurements
- Foot shapes
- Hand dimensions
The result can be PPE that technically falls within the available size range but does not fit individual workers particularly well.
A broader size range can sometimes improve usability and reduce the temptation for workers to modify PPE themselves.
The right approach depends on the workforce and product category.
4. Fit Should Be Evaluated With Other PPE
Workers rarely use one piece of PPE in isolation.
They may wear:
Helmet + Eye Protection + Hearing Protection + Respiratory Protection + Protective Clothing + Gloves + Safety Footwear
These products need to work together.
For example:
- Eyewear should not create unnecessary interference with a helmet.
- Gloves should work with protective sleeves.
- Clothing should allow workers to use gloves effectively.
- Head protection accessories should not create excessive pressure.
- Respiratory equipment may interact with other face-worn equipment.
This is why purchasing each PPE item independently can sometimes create unexpected compatibility problems.
The worker wears the PPE system—not individual products in isolation.
That is an important concept for procurement teams.
5. Worker Movement Is Part of Fit
A common mistake is evaluating PPE while the wearer is standing still.
Real work is different.
Ask the worker to perform representative tasks:
- Reach forward
- Raise both arms
- Bend
- Squat
- Walk
- Climb
- Grip tools
- Turn the head
- Sit and stand
Then observe whether the PPE:
- Moves out of position
- Restricts movement
- Creates pressure
- Exposes areas that should remain covered
- Interferes with other equipment
- Becomes difficult to use
This type of practical evaluation can reveal issues that are difficult to identify from measurements alone.
6. Comfort Is Not the Same as Softness
When people hear “comfortable PPE,” they may immediately think about soft materials.
But comfort is broader than softness.
It can involve:
- Weight
- Pressure distribution
- Temperature
- Moisture management
- Flexibility
- Movement
- Fit
- Adjustability
- Breathability
- Ease of use
A soft material does not automatically create a comfortable product.
Likewise, a lightweight product is not automatically suitable if it does not provide the required protection.
A better way to think about comfort is:
How does the PPE behave during the entire task?
Not:
How does it feel for the first five minutes?
7. Long Shifts Reveal Fit Problems
Some fit problems are not obvious during a short product inspection.
A product may feel acceptable for ten minutes but become uncomfortable after several hours.
Long-duration use can reveal:
- Pressure points
- Heat buildup
- Chafing
- Hand fatigue
- Foot discomfort
- Restricted movement
- Excessive weight
This is particularly relevant for workers who wear PPE throughout most of their shift.
For these applications, sample evaluation should ideally consider realistic wearing conditions rather than relying entirely on a quick visual inspection.
8. Don’t Confuse a Size Chart With a Fit Test
A size chart is useful.
It provides measurements and helps buyers select an appropriate size.
But a size chart cannot answer every practical question.
Two garments with the same nominal size can have different:
- Cut
- Proportions
- Sleeve length
- Body length
- Shoulder construction
- Waist design
- Mobility allowance
The same principle applies to footwear and gloves.
Therefore:
Size tells you where a product sits on a measurement chart. Fit tells you how it works on a person.
For important or customized PPE programs, actual samples can provide valuable information that specifications alone cannot provide.
9. Fit Matters Even More for Customized PPE
Customization is often discussed in terms of:
- Logo
- Color
- Fabric
- Packaging
- Labels
But fit can also be part of customization.
For example, buyers may require:
- Different size ranges
- Different garment cuts
- Specific sleeve lengths
- Adjustable waist systems
- Special footwear requirements
- Different glove sizes
- Customized dimensions for particular applications
The more specialized the workforce or task, the more important it can become to define fit requirements before bulk production.
For customized products, buyers should avoid assuming that changing one measurement will automatically improve the entire fit.
Product construction needs to be considered as a whole.
10. Better Fit Can Support Better PPE Acceptance
PPE compliance is influenced by many factors.
Training matters.
Supervision matters.
Workplace culture matters.
But usability matters too.
If PPE is difficult to wear, difficult to adjust, excessively restrictive, or uncomfortable during normal work, workers may be less willing to use it correctly.
This creates an important relationship:
Better Fit → Better Usability → Better Acceptance → More Consistent Use
Fit alone cannot guarantee correct PPE use.
But poor fit can create an unnecessary barrier.
For employers and procurement teams, that is a reason to treat fit as part of the purchasing decision rather than leaving it entirely to the end user.
How Should Buyers Evaluate PPE Fit?
A practical fit evaluation can follow five questions.
1. Does It Stay in Position?
The PPE should remain appropriately positioned during normal movement.
2. Does It Restrict Necessary Movement?
Workers should be able to perform their normal tasks without unnecessary restriction.
3. Does It Create Excessive Pressure?
Check common pressure points and areas of repeated contact.
4. Does It Work With Other PPE?
Consider the complete PPE combination rather than one item at a time.
5. Can Workers Use It Correctly?
Adjustment systems, closures, straps, and other features should be practical for the intended users.
This five-point check can be used during sample evaluation before a larger purchase.
Questions to Ask Your PPE Supplier About Fit
Before placing an order, buyers can ask:
- What size range is available?
- How are the sizes measured?
- Is a size chart available?
- Are different fits or cuts available?
- Can samples be provided?
- Can different sizes be tested by workers?
- Are there adjustable features?
- How does the product interact with other PPE?
- Can the design be customized?
- Are alternative models available for different body types or applications?
These questions are particularly useful for large workforce deployments.

Fit Should Be Part of the Procurement Specification
One of the easiest ways to overlook fit is to treat it as something that happens after purchasing.
A better process is:
Requirement → Product Selection → Size & Fit → Sample Evaluation → Worker Feedback → Final Approval
This does not mean every PPE purchase requires extensive field testing.
The evaluation should be proportional to the product, risk, workforce, and application.
But for large, customized, or frequently worn PPE, fit deserves a place in the procurement conversation from the beginning.
